

BODY, P, DIV, TABLE, TD, TH,  DD, DIR, DIV, DL, DT, UL, OL, LI
{ font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t;}

div.pagebody {margin-top: 2em}

TABLE#border
{FONT-FAMILY: verdana,arial,sans-serif; FONT-SIZE: 10pt; padding: 5px; border-width: 2px; border-color:#000000; border-style: solid; margin-left: 5px; margin-bottom: 5px}

td.content {padding-top: 2em; text-align:top}

li {margin-bottom:8px;}

H1 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12pt; font-weight: bold;  text-decoration: none; color:#CB1920}

H2 {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t; font-weight: bold;  text-decoration: none; margin-top:20px; margin-bottom:0px; }



.arial8pt {  font-family: Arial, Helvetica, sans-serif; font-size: 8pt; color:#000; text-decoration: none}

.arial9pt {  font-family: Arial, Helvetica, sans-serif; font-size: 9pt; color:#000; text-decoration: none}

.arial9ptb {  font-family: Arial, Helvetica, sans-serif; font-size: 9pt;color:#000; text-decoration: none; font-weight:bold}

.black8pt {font-size: 8pt; color:#000}

.black8ptb {font-size: 8pt; font-weight: bold; color:#000; text-decoration: none;}

.black8ptbi { font-size: 8pt; font-style:italic; font-weight: bold; color:#000; text-decoration: none}

.black8ptu {font-size: 8pt; color:#000; text-decoration:underline}

.black8ptbu {font-size: 8pt; font-weight: bold; color:#000; text-decoration: underline }

.black9pt {font-size: 9pt;  color:#000; text-decoration: none}

.black9ptu { font-size: 11px; text-decoration: underline; color:#000} 

.black9ptb {font-size: 9pt; font-weight: bold; color:#000; text-decoration: none }

.black9ptbu {font-size: 9pt; font-weight: bold;  text-decoration: underline; color: #000}

.black9ptbi {font-size: 9pt; font-weight: bold; color:#000; font-style:italic;}

.black9pti {font-size: 9pt; font-style: italic; color:#000; text-decoration: none}

.black10pt {font-size: 10pt;  color:#000; text-decoration: none}

.black10ptb {font-size: 10pt; font-weight: bold; color:#000; text-decoration: none;}

.black10ptbi {font-size: 10pt; font-style: italic; font-weight: bold; color:#000; text-decoration: none}

.black10pti {font-size: 10pt; font-style: italic; color:#000; text-decoration: none}

.black10ptbu {font-size: 10pt; font-weight: bold; text-decoration: underline; color: #000}

.black11ptb {font-size: 11pt; font-weight: bold; color:#000} 

.black11ptbu {font-size: 11pt; font-weight:bold; color:#000; text-decoration: underline}

.black12ptb {font-size: 12pt; font-weight: bold; color:#000} 

.black12ptbu {font-size: 12pt; font-weight: bold; color:#000; text-decoration: underline} 

.black13ptb {font-size: 13pt; font-weight: bold; line-height: normal; color:#000; text-decoration: none}

.black13ptbu {font-size: 13pt; font-weight: bold; color:#000; text-decoration: underline}

.black14pt
 {font-size: 14pt; color: #000}

.black14ptb
 {font-size: 14pt;  font-weight: bold; color: #000}

.black14ptbu
 {font-size: 14pt;  font-weight: bold; color: #000; text-decoration: underline}
 
.black16ptb {font-size: 16pt; font-weight: bold; color: #000; text-decoration: none}

.blue8pt {font-size: 8pt;}
.blue8ptu {font-size: 8pt;  text-decoration: underline; color:#0033cc}

.blue9pt {font-size: 9pt;  text-decoration: none; color:#0033cc}

.blue9ptb {font-size: 9pt;  text-decoration: none; color:#0033cc; font-weight:  bold;}

.blue9ptbu {font-size: 9pt;  text-decoration: none; color:#0033cc; text-decoration: underline; font-weight: bold;}

.blue9ptu { font-size: 9pt;  color:#0033cc; text-decoration: underline}

.blue10ptbu {font-size: 10pt; font-weight:bold; color:#0033cc; text-decoration: underline}

.blue11ptbu {font-size: 11pt;  text-decoration: none; color:#0033cc; text-decoration: underline}

.captions {font-size: 10px; text-decoration: none; color:#000}

.captionnames {font-size: 10px; font-weight: bold; text-decoration: none; color:#666}

.counselors {font-size: 11px; font-weight: bold;  text-decoration: underline}

.greentitles {font-size: 12pt; font-weight: bold; text-decoration: none; color:#006633}

.green8ptbLH1 {font-size: 8pt;  text-decoration: none; color:#006633; font-weight: bold; }

.green8ptbLH1u {font-size: 8pt;  text-decoration: underline; color:#006633; font-weight: bold; }

.green8ptb {font-size: 8pt; font-weight: bold;  color: #006633; text-decoration: none}

.green10ptbi {font-size: 10pt; font-weight: bold; font-style:italic; color: #006633; text-decoration: none}

.green10ptb {font-size: 10pt; font-weight: bold; color: #006633; text-decoration: none}

.green10ptbu {font-size: 10pt; font-weight: bold; color: #006633; text-decoration: underline}

.green11ptb { font-size: 11pt; font-weight: bold;  color: #006633; text-decoration: none}



.ind3 {padding-left: 3em}
.ind6 {padding-left: 6em}
.links { font-size: 8pt; color: #999; text-decoration: none; font-weight: bold; line-height:130%;}

.linksdkgrey { font-size: 8pt; color: #666; text-decoration: none; font-weight: bold}

.linksblack { font-size: 8pt; color: #000; text-decoration: none; font-weight: bold}

.linksdkgreyu {font-size: 8pt;   color: #666; text-decoration: underline }

.linksdkgreyb {font-size: 8pt; font-weight: bold; color: #666; text-decoration: none }

.notes { font-size: 9pt; font-weight: bold; color:#0033CC}

.pagetitles { font-size: 12pt; font-weight: bold;  text-decoration: none; color:#CB1920}

.pagesubtitles {font-size: 10pt; font-weight: bold;  text-decoration: none}

.purple12pxb {font-size: 12px; text-decoration: none; font-weight: bold; color: #6633cc; }

.purple12pxbu {font-size: 12px; text-decoration: underline; font-weight: bold; color: #6633cc}

.red8pt {font-size: 8pt; color: #CB1920; text-decoration: none}

.red8ptu {font-size: 8pt; color: #CB1920; text-decoration: underline}

.red8ptb {font-size: 8pt; font-weight: bold;  color: #CB1920; text-decoration: none}

.red8ptbu { font-size: 8pt; font-weight: bold;  color: #CB1920; text-decoration: underline}

.red8ptbu {font-size: 8pt;  text-decoration: underline; color: #CB1920}

.red9ptb { font-size: 9pt; font-weight: bold; line-height: normal; color: #CB1920; text-decoration: none}

.red9ptbu { font-size: 9pt; font-weight: bold; color: #CB1920; text-decoration: underline}

.red10ptb {font-weight: bold;  color: #CB1920; text-decoration: none}

.red10ptbu { font-weight: bold;  color: #CB1920; text-decoration: underline}

.red10ptbi {  font-weight: bold; font-style:italic;  color: #CB1920; text-decoration: none}

.red11ptb { font-size: 11pt; font-weight: bold;  color: #CB1920; text-decoration: none}

.red11ptbu {font-size: 11pt; font-weight: bold; color: #CB1920; text-decoration: underline}

.red12ptb {font-size: 12pt; font-weight: bold; color: #CB1920; text-decoration: none}

.red12ptbu {font-size: 12pt; font-weight: bold; color: #CB1920; text-decoration: underline}

.red12ptbi { font-size: 12pt; font-weight: bold; font-style: italic;  color: #CB1920; text-decoration: none}

.red14ptb { font-size: 14pt; font-weight: bold;  color: #CB1920; text-decoration: none}

.red13ptbu {font-size: 13pt; font-weight:bold; color: #cb1920; text-decoration:underline}


.red16ti { font-family: Times, Times New Roman, serif; font-size: 16pt; font-weight: bold; font-style: italic;  color: #CB1920; text-decoration: none}


.search { font-size: 12px; font-style: bold;  color: #CB1920; text-decoration: none}

.sportsnav {font-size: 9pt;  text-decoration: underline; color: #000000; font-weight: bold;}

.sportsgrey {font-size: 9pt;  text-decoration: underline; color: #666666; font-weight: bold;}

.tan10ptb {font-size: 10pt;  font-weight: bold; color: #ffcc99; text-decoration: none}

.tan8ptb {font-size: 8pt;  font-weight: bold; color: #ffcc99}

.tan8ptbu {font-size: 8pt;  font-weight: bold; color: #ffcc99; text-decoration: underline}

.tan9ptb {font-size: 9pt; font-weight: bold; color: #ffcc99; text-decoration: none}


      
.white8ptb {font-size: 8pt;   color: #fff; font-weight: bold; text-decoration: none}

.white8pt {font-size: 8pt;   color: #fff}

.white8ptu {font-size: 8pt;   color: #fff; text-decoration: underline}

.white9pt {font-size: 9pt;  font-weight: bold; color: #fff; text-decoration: none}

.white9ptb {font-size: 9pt;  font-weight: bold; color: #fff; text-decoration: none}

.white9ptbi {font-size: 9pt;  font-weight: bold; color:#fff; font-style:italic}

.white9ptbu { font-size: 9pt;  font-weight: bold; color: #fff; text-decoration: underline}

.white10pt {font-size: 10pt; color: #fff; text-decoration: none}

.white10ptb {font-size: 10pt; font-weight: bold; color: #fff; text-decoration: none}

.white10ptbi {font-size: 10pt; font-weight: bold; color: #fff; font-style: italic;}

.white11ptb { font-size: 11pt;  font-weight: bold; color: #fff; text-decoration: none}

.white10ptbu { font-size: 10pt;  font-weight: bold; color: #fff; text-decoration: underline}

.white10ptu {font-size: 10pt; text-decoration: underline; font-weight: bold; color: #fff}

.white11ptbi { font-size: 11pt;   color: #fff; font-style: italic; font-weight:bold}

.white12ptb { font-size: 12pt;  font-weight: bold; color: #fff}
.white13ptb { font-size: 13pt;  font-weight: bold; color: #fff}
.white14pt {font-size: 14pt; color: #fff}

.white14ptb { font-size: 14pt;  font-weight: bold; color: #fff}

.white14ptbu { font-size: 14pt;  font-weight: bold; color: #fff; text-decoration:underline;}

td#toprow {background: #cb1920;  FONT-FAMILY: verdana, arial,sans-serif; FONT-SIZE: 8pt;  font-weight: bold; color:#ffffff; padding: 6px 3px;
border-style: solid;
border-width : 1px 1px 1px 1px;
 border-color:#000000; text-align:center; margin: 0px }

td#hilite {background: #cc9966;  FONT-FAMILY: verdana, arial,sans-serif; FONT-SIZE: 8pt;  font-weight: bold; color:#ffffff; padding: 6px 3px;
border-style: solid;
border-width : 1px 1px 1px 1px;
 border-color:#000000; text-align:center; margin: 0px }

div#footer {text-align: center; margin-top: 2.5 em; border-top: 3px solid #cb1920; font-size: 85%}

div#footer_main {text-align: center; margin-top: .5 em; border-top: 3px solid #cb1920; font-size: 85%; width:700px;}


table#nav {margin-right: 10pt; margin-top:10pt; border-right : 1px solid #cccccc;  color:#000;}
td.link {padding: .2em .5em .2em 0em;}
td.link_indent {padding: .2em .5em .2em 1em;}

.navlink {font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; font-weight: bold; text-decoration: none; color: #000;}

.navlink a:link {font-size: 8pt; font-weight: bold; color:#000; text-decoration: none;}

.navlink A:visited {font-size: 8pt; font-weight: bold; color:#000; text-decoration: none;}

.navlink A:active {font-size: 8pt; font-weight: bold; color:#000; text-decoration: none;}

.navlink_indent {padding: 0px 0px 0px 10px; font-weight:bold; font-size: 8pt;}

.second_indent {padding: 0px 0px 0px 20px;}

.navlink_indent a:link {font-size: 8pt; font-weight: bold; color:#000; text-decoration: none;}

.navlink_indent A:visited {font-size: 8pt; font-weight: bold; color:#000; text-decoration: none;}

.navlink_indent A:active {font-size: 8pt; font-weight: bold; color:#000; text-decoration: none;}

.navlink_red {padding: .2em .5em .2em 0em; color:#900}

.navlink_red a:link {font-size: 8pt; font-weight: bold; color:#900; text-decoration: none;}

.navlink_red A:visited {font-size: 8pt; font-weight: bold; color:#900; text-decoration: none;}

.navlink_red A:active {font-size: 8pt; font-weight: bold; color:#900; text-decoration: none;}






	#navcontainer
{
margin: 0;
padding: 0 0 0 0px;
}

#navcontainer UL
{

list-style: none;
margin: 0;
padding: 0;
border: none;
width: 700pt;
}

#navcontainer LI
{
FONT-FAMILY: verdana, arial,sans-serif; FONT-SIZE: 8pt;  font-weight: bold;
display: block;
margin: 0;
padding: 0;
float: left;
width: auto;
}

#navcontainer A
{
color: #ffffff;
display: block;
width: auto;
text-decoration: none;
background: #CB1920;
margin: 0;
padding: 5px 5px;
border-left: 1px solid #000;
border-top: 1px solid #000;
border-right: 1px solid #000;
}

#navcontainer A:hover { background: #c96; }

#navcontainer A.active:link, #navcontainer A.active:visited
{
position: relative;
z-index: 102;
background: #c96;
font-weight: bold;
}



gin: 0;
padding: 5px 5px;
border-left: 1px solid #000;
border-top: 1px solid #000;
border-right: 1px solid #000;
}

#navcontainer A:hover { background: #c96; }

#navcontainer A.active:link, #navcontainer A.active:visited
{
position: relative;
z-index: 102;
background: #c96;
font-weight: bold;
}




